Colombian President Orders Immigration Raids, Vows Deportations of Migrants without Legal Status

  • On Monday, President Abelardo de la Espriella ordered immigration authorities to prioritize deportations for foreign nationals committing crimes or lacking regular status, following a security cabinet meeting in Barranquilla on Sunday.
  • Since assuming office on August 7, the president has campaigned on dismantling drug-trafficking guerrilla groups and stated, "I will not accept illegal migrants," citing admiration for President Donald Trump's nationalist approach.
  • The government reported 1,574 captures and 10 extraditions since August 7, alongside seizure of 23,642 kilos of drugs, including 12,296 kilos of cocaine, in intensified offensives against criminal organizations across Colombia.
  • Officials clarified that deportation orders target individuals based on criminal activity or status rather than membership in armed groups like Segunda Marquetalia or Clan del Golfo, maintaining distinct security operations.
  • Beyond security measures, the licensing agency ANLA authorized Hidroituango to raise reservoir levels to 420 meters as a preventive measure against a forecast "very strong" El Niño lasting until July 31, 2027.
